Amid the poverty in which Cubans live, without enough income to eat properly, a luxurious mansion in the exclusive neighborhood of Miramar has been put up for sale for 60 thousand dollars.

This residence, unattainable for the average citizen, is a clear reflection of the deep economic inequalities that exist in Cuba, where the elite of the dictatorship has properties valued at thousands of dollars, while the average Cuban struggles in his home that is in danger of collapse.

The mansion, built in the colonial style, is in excellent condition and offers a wide range of amenities that are inaccessible to the majority of the population.

It consists of wide side corridors, a reception area, a spacious living room, a hall, a dining room, a kitchen, two balconies overlooking the street, terraces on the ground floor and on the upper floor, a patio, a garage, and six air-conditioned rooms with closets and six bathrooms.

While the Antilleans struggle daily to survive in extremely precarious conditions, this type of property can only be acquired by those who are in privileged positions, often related to the dictatorship.

The sale of this mansion not only highlights the lack of economic contrast, but also the disconnect between the basic needs of the majority and the luxuries that a minority can afford.

In a post by Maricee Álvarez, she wrote a contact number for those interested, who cannot be ordinary citizens, since the purchasing power on the island is zero for sales of that type.
